Minimum wage vs family living wage per region as of July 2023
August 8, 2023
The NCR minimum wage still falls short of the regional family living wage (FLW) despite the recent wage hike. Across the regions, minimum wages are likewise insufficient compared to the regional FLW. The biggest FLW-nominal wage gap is in BARMM with only Php341 in nominal wages versus a Php1,947 FLW.

Php170 wage hike only 16.2% of enterprise profits
June 7, 2023
The family living wage is Php1,160 as of May 2023. However, minimum wages since wage regionalization in 1989 don’t just fall far short of the ever rising living wage — they haven’t even kept up with inflation.
